How to take the fourth derivative of a reflectance graph

1 visualizzazione (ultimi 30 giorni)
Hi I am looking to calculate and plot the fourth derivtative of a reflectance plot for coral spectra - commonly done in papers by the savistky and golay, 1964 method.
I have used the smoothing function on my coral mean spectra (x3) (1st image)
S2 = smooth(S1);
plot(wv1, S2);
xlim([400 750])
Then went to take my 1st derivative (2nd image)
This turned out ok using this coding:
dy = diff(S2)/diff(wv1);
plot(wv1(2:end),dy)
xlim([400 750])
But I believe this is the wrong method for taking the derivative of the reflectance spectra as I loose data going fromm 1446x1 to 1445x1 each time i derive i.e.
taking the second derivative like so:
d2ydx2 = diff(dy)./diff(wv1);
plot(wv1(1:1444),d2ydx2)
xlim([400 750])
producing a graph like image 3 - which when it comes to the 4th i have lost nearly all the data (image 4)
Does anyone know where I am going wrong, as this must be much more straight forward given it has been used so frequently.
Thanks

If you have the signal processing toolbox licenced, use "sgolay" and "sgolayfilt".
Or download from the file exchange:
https://de.mathworks.com/matlabcentral/fileexchange/30299-savitzky-golay-smooth-differentiation-filters-and-filter-application
